Definitions
The exploration of man-made environments, especially urban structures that are abandoned or off-limits; urban exploration.

Examples
“Simon didn't need⟳ reminding about the dangers of urbex, but Matt was on a roll.[…]It had been Matt's blog that had got Simon into urbex.”
“For example, in Belgium, we have⟳ some great urbex (urban exploration) locations (old empty buildings) where you can go and shoot⟳.”
“Ultimately, urbex remains a kind of cipher—occasionally, it catches media attention, and is grouped with other subcultures, like⟳ parkour, or even steampunk (Dawdy 2010), that are somehow "remixing" or renegotiating ways to relate⟳ to space, and how particular spaces are envisioned to exist⟳ within time.”
